Verification Processes in Live Settings

Live environments rely on automated checks combined with manual reviews, and experts observe that these steps vary by payment method and jurisdiction. Bank transfers typically require more extensive confirmation than digital wallets, which affects the speed at which funds become available for continued play. Studies reveal that platforms operating in multiple regions apply tiered protocols, where initial deposits trigger faster reviews than subsequent ones once account history builds up.

Those who monitor transaction flows report that verification often occurs in stages, beginning with basic identity confirmation and moving to risk assessment layers. This sequence influences session continuity because players who encounter delays may pause activity rather than switch games immediately. Figures from industry monitoring services show that verification completion rates improve when systems integrate real-time data feeds from financial institutions.
